In-State vs Out-of-State Tuition
Hopkinsville Community College is listed as Public in the local dataset. In-state tuition is $4,656 and out-of-state tuition is $6,192. Compare both values before estimating your bill, especially if residency status may affect pricing.

Average Net Price After Aid
Based on available data, the average student at Hopkinsville Community College pays approximately $3,939 per year after grants and aid. This is below the Kentucky average of $15,306 and below the national average of $17,506.

Financial Aid and Scholarships
About 42.80% of Hopkinsville Community College students receive federal Pell grants, indicating the share of students receiving this need-based aid in the local dataset. 12.97% take federal loans, which helps families understand borrowing patterns alongside net price.

Student Debt and Borrowing
Borrowing metrics help explain how students finance the gap between sticker price, aid and net price. Loans can make a bill payable, but they do not reduce the underlying cost like grants and scholarships.
Loan principal
$6,999
Median completer debt
$10,691
Median monthly payment
$113
Federal loan rate
12.97%
Debt and payment fields come from federal aid data where reported. Actual borrowing can vary by degree level, dependency status, aid package, family contribution and program costs.
